Zimbabweans Call For Boycott Of South African Shows


Several high profile South African artists will be performing in Zimbabwe in the coming weeks.

Following the violent xenophobic attacks in KwaZulu-Natal, some Zimbabweans have told South African hip-hop star Cassper Nyovest that he is not welcome in Zimbabwe. Nyovest is set to perform in Bulawayo, Zimbabwe on 25 April, but some say that because South Africans don't want Zimbabweans in South Africa, Zimbabweans don't want Nyovest in Zimbabwe. RA'EESA PATHER explains.
Nyovest, the man behind hip hop hits Gusheshe and Doc Shebeleza, has been advised to cancel his performance in Bulawayo after being threatened by Zimbabweans on social media. A Facebook post by Zimbabwean musician, Augustus Baba Zaine Verunga, helped spur the furore after he called on Zimbabweans to boycott Nyovest's show.
"This show will not happen, and if it does it will not end well. We'll send a message to every SA citizen watching, partaking and promoting XENOPHOBIA," Verurunga wrote on Facebook.
Nyovest's mother saw the Facebook post, and called the rapper, asking him to cancel his performance.
